


3-Card Combination
Navigating Shadows and Celebrations
This combination speaks to the interplay between hidden emotions, community support, and the burdens we carry. While the Moon suggests uncertainty and introspection, the Three of Cups brings joy through connection, and the Ten of Wands highlights the weight of responsibilities.
The Moon
Upright: illusion, fear, the subconscious, anxiety
Reversed: release of fear, repressed emotion, inner confusion
Three of Cups
Upright: celebration, friendship, community, reunion
Reversed: overindulgence, gossip, isolation
Ten of Wands
Upright: burden, extra responsibility, hard work, completion
Reversed: inability to delegate, carrying too much, burnout
All Upright
When all three cards are upright, they indicate a period of emotional depth and celebration amidst challenges. The Moon encourages you to confront your fears and explore your subconscious, while the Three of Cups emphasizes the importance of friendship and support during this journey. Meanwhile, the Ten of Wands suggests that while you may feel overwhelmed, sharing your burdens with loved ones can lighten your load.
The Moon Reversed
When The Moon is reversed, it indicates a potential for clarity and the surfacing of hidden truths. You may begin to confront your fears or illusions, leading to a more grounded perspective. However, be cautious of deceptive influences or unresolved emotional issues that may still linger.
Three of Cups Reversed
The Three of Cups reversed can signify a lack of harmony within social circles or a feeling of isolation. You may find that friendships are strained or that past celebrations now feel hollow. This card urges you to examine your connections and seek genuine support rather than superficial interactions.
Ten of Wands Reversed
When the Ten of Wands is reversed, it suggests a need to let go of burdens that no longer serve you. You may be on the verge of release, allowing you to delegate responsibilities or ask for help. This card encourages prioritizing self-care and recognizing that you don’t have to carry everything alone.
All Reversed
With all three cards reversed, there is a strong sense of disconnection and emotional turmoil. The Moon indicates confusion and unresolved fears, the Three of Cups points to isolation or discord among friends, and the Ten of Wands reveals a struggle to release burdens. Together, they emphasize the need for introspection and the importance of seeking genuine connections to navigate this challenging period.
Love & Relationships
In relationships, this combination suggests that unresolved fears or insecurities may be causing rifts between partners. It’s essential to communicate openly and seek clarity rather than retreating into isolation. Reconnecting with friends or seeking support can help rejuvenate romantic bonds.
Career & Finances
In a career context, this reading indicates potential stress and overwhelming responsibilities that may obscure your path. It’s crucial to seek collaboration and support from colleagues, as shared efforts can lead to more balanced workloads and renewed motivation. Don't hesitate to reassess your goals and lighten your load where possible.
Advice
Take time to reflect on your emotional landscape and the burdens you carry. Reach out to your support network for companionship and assistance, as connection can provide clarity and relief. Prioritize self-care and remember that you don’t have to face challenges alone—sharing your load can lead to newfound strength.
